Max Levchin, co-founder and CEO of Affirm, recognizes that his users today will not be daily visitors to Affirm’s website. To help fix that he has acquired Sweep, which provides consumers with a view of their future cashflow. Data that hopefully consumers check-in on more frequently.
The app, founded in 2014, provides users with a future view of their cashflow so they can better plan ahead for things like bills and other expenses. Essentially, the app collates all of your financial activity into a single dashboard, which could function as an alternative to simply checking your account balance. And, since most Americans check their bank account balance daily, there’s a good chance Sweep’s users do the same. This is the exact type of daily engagement that Affirm is looking to incorporate into their product offerings, which makes the acquisition a perfect fit for the company.
